I'm a complete beginner but would like a project for the evening and fancied making woollen squares that I can then stitch together to make a blanket.

I'd like for some of the squares to have patterns (nothing too ambitious, maybe stripes!)

But I don't know whether to knit or crochet (or both???)

Which is easier to learn?

I can do both and find crochet MUCH easier (only one hook to contend with and less catastrophic if you make a mistake). MIL is the other way round, loves knitting, hates crochet.

Really you need to try both and see which suits you. This blog is a mecca for crochet inspiration attic 24 - have a look at the side for crochet. Her tutorials are excellent. Actually googling Attic 24 and going to images is good too.
Ravelry is excellent for free patterns for both knitting and crochet.
